No open fires (this includes charcoal) are permitted anywhere in the park. Only stoves or lanterns using containerized fuel are permitted.
Dog Canyon Campground is remote. Fuel your vehicle and purchase supplies before heading to the park.
Keep all food and related items - beverages, toiletry items, cooking utensils, stoves, pet food (empty or full), and food and beverage containers such as coolers, ice chests, and water jugs - locked inside your vehicle, unless in immediate use. Bear resistant food containers must be kept in a vehicle or in a hard-sided camping unit.
A free Wilderness Use Permit for all trail riding in the park must be obtained at the Pine Springs Visitor Center.
Tent camping is not permitted in an RV campsite.
Cell phone service is not available.
